diff --git a/src/Fl_XPM_Image.cxx b/src/Fl_XPM_Image.cxx new file mode 100644 index 000000000..d29429599 --- /dev/null +++ b/src/Fl_XPM_Image.cxx @@ -0,0 +1,129 @@ +// +// "$Id: Fl_XPM_Image.cxx,v 1.1.2.1 2001/11/24 18:07:57 easysw Exp $" +// +// Fl_XPM_Image routines. +// +// Copyright 1997-2001 by Bill Spitzak and others. +// +// This library is free software; you can redistribute it and/or +// modify it under the terms of the GNU Library General Public +// License as published by the Free Software Foundation; either +// version 2 of the License, or (at your option) any later version. +// +// This library is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, +// but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of +// M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the GNU +// Library General Public License for more details. +// +// You should have received a copy of the GNU Library General Public +// License along with this library; if not, write to the Free Software +// Foundation, Inc., 59 Temple Place, Suite 330, Boston, MA 02111-1307 +// USA. +// +// Please report all bugs and problems to "fltk-bugs@fltk.org". +// +// Contents: +// +// + +// +// Include necessary header files... +// + +#include <FL/Fl.H> +#include <FL/Fl_XPM_Image.H> +#include "config.h" +#include <stdio.h> +#include <stdlib.h> +#include <string.h> +#include <ctype.h> + + +// +// 'hexdigit()' - Convert a hex digit to an integer. +// + +static int hexdigit(int x) { // I - Hex digit... + if (isdigit(x)) return x-'0'; + if (isupper(x)) return x-'A'+10; + if (islower(x)) return x-'a'+10; + return 20; +} + +#define MAXSIZE 2048 +#define INITIALLINES 256 + +Fl_XPM_Image::Fl_XPM_Image(const char *name) : Fl_Pixmap((char *const*)0) { + FILE *f; + + if ((f = fopen(name, "rb")) == NULL) return; + + // read all the c-strings out of the file: + char** new_data = new char *[INITIALLINES]; + char** temp_data; + int malloc_size = INITIALLINES; + char buffer[MAXSIZE+20]; + int i = 0; + while (fgets(buffer,MAXSIZE+20,f)) { + if (buffer[0] != '\"') continue; + char *myp = buffer; + char *q = buffer+1; + while (*q != '\"' && myp < buffer+MAXSIZE) { + if (*q == '\\') switch (*++q) { + case '\r': + case '\n': + fgets(q,(buffer+MAXSIZE+20)-q,f); break; + case 0: + break; + case 'x': { + q++; + int n = 0; + for (int x = 0; x < 3; x++) { + int d = hexdigit(*q); + if (d > 15) break; + n = (n<<4)+d; + q++; + } + *myp++ = n; + } break; + default: { + int c = *q++; + if (c>='0' && c<='7') { + c -= '0'; + for (int x=0; x<2; x++) { + int d = hexdigit(*q); + if (d>7) break; + c = (c<<3)+d; + q++; + } + } + *myp++ = c; + } break; + } else { + *myp++ = *q++; + } + } + *myp++ = 0; + if (i >= malloc_size) { + temp_data = new char *[malloc_size + INITIALLINES]; + memcpy(temp_data, new_data, sizeof(char *) * malloc_size); + delete[] new_data; + new_data = temp_data; + malloc_size += INITIALLINES; + } + new_data[i] = new char[myp-buffer+1]; + memcpy(new_data[i], buffer,myp-buffer); + new_data[i][myp-buffer] = 0; + i++; + } + + fclose(f); + + data(new_data, i); + measure(); +} + + +// +// End of "$Id: Fl_XPM_Image.cxx,v 1.1.2.1 2001/11/24 18:07:57 easysw Exp $". +// |
